BLOG Small Press Creators Assemble

SFX Blogger Stacey Whittle goes to the pub… and finds it full of comic creators

There were about a dozen small press creator tables and a communal table which housed a stack of small press comics donated from OK Comics and an area for creators without their own table to leave their comics for sale. I had a chat with Hugh and Steve and they told me that their event had been really easy to organise; The Nation of Shopkeepers had given space for free and so they didn’t charge any creators for their tables, the nice thing about that is that they knew all the creators who came would walk away with profit – which as I understand is harder and harder for the small press to do at the bigger comic events.
